0:06:16.160 --> 0:06:18.320
<v Speaker 1>It's actually very simple. All you have to do is

0:06:18.320 --> 0:06:20.920
<v Speaker 1>figure out the square footage of your roof, because your

0:06:20.960 --> 0:06:24.200
<v Speaker 1>roof actss the water catchment, and the water that hits

0:06:24.200 --> 0:06:27.279
<v Speaker 1>your roof is going to flow eventually into your rain barrel. Right,

0:06:28.040 --> 0:06:31.440
<v Speaker 1>So let's say that you have a twelve hundred square

0:06:31.440 --> 0:06:36.359
<v Speaker 1>foot roof, right, you will get seven hundred and twenty

0:06:36.400 --> 0:06:40.240
<v Speaker 1>gallons of water from one inch of rainfall, oh, just

0:06:40.279 --> 0:06:43.480
<v Speaker 1>from having that roof. Right. And I arrived at that

0:06:43.520 --> 0:06:48.240
<v Speaker 1>figure by taking the width of the roof, multiplying it

0:06:48.279 --> 0:06:49.960
<v Speaker 1>by the length of the roof, and you got the

0:06:49.960 --> 0:06:53.200
<v Speaker 1>square footage of the roof, and then multiplying that number

0:06:53.240 --> 0:06:55.560
<v Speaker 1>the square footage by point six, which is the portion

0:06:55.640 --> 0:06:58.920
<v Speaker 1>of the gallon that will be harvested from one inch

0:06:58.960 --> 0:07:02.000
<v Speaker 1>of rainwater falling on one square foot of your roof.

0:07:02.480 --> 0:07:04.760
<v Speaker 1>And like I said, if you have twelve hundred square

0:07:04.760 --> 0:07:07.400
<v Speaker 1>feet of roof, that's going to yield seven hundred and

0:07:07.400 --> 0:07:08.960
<v Speaker 1>twenty gallons.

0:07:34.360 --> 0:07:36.440
<v Speaker 3>So we need to talk roofs though, because it depends

0:07:36.440 --> 0:07:37.840
<v Speaker 3>on what kind of roof you have as to like

0:07:37.880 --> 0:07:39.240
<v Speaker 3>how great that water is going to be.

0:07:40.120 --> 0:07:41.760
<v Speaker 2>If you've got like a brand.

0:07:41.480 --> 0:07:46.480
<v Speaker 3>New asbestos tard asphalt shingled roof, you're probably not going

0:07:46.560 --> 0:07:47.720
<v Speaker 3>to like love that rain water.

0:07:47.800 --> 0:07:51.240
<v Speaker 2>It's not great treated cedar shakes or lovely.

0:07:51.800 --> 0:07:54.080
<v Speaker 3>But they are treated with stuff that you're not gonna want,

0:07:54.120 --> 0:07:59.560
<v Speaker 3>like arsenick to keep them from riding. Obviously galvanized metal.

0:07:59.640 --> 0:08:01.880
<v Speaker 3>Some people say, like, that's probably the best thing, right,

0:08:01.960 --> 0:08:02.800
<v Speaker 3>What do you say.

0:08:03.920 --> 0:08:06.600
<v Speaker 1>Probably not, because most metal roofs are treated with a

0:08:06.680 --> 0:08:10.360
<v Speaker 1>protective coating that's made of peafasts, so that's going to

0:08:10.400 --> 0:08:13.400
<v Speaker 1>get right into your water too. It turns out that

0:08:13.600 --> 0:08:17.200
<v Speaker 1>slate tiles, terra cotta tiles, or ceramic roof tiles are

0:08:17.240 --> 0:08:20.080
<v Speaker 1>probably the best they're going to contribute the least amount

0:08:20.080 --> 0:08:24.240
<v Speaker 1>of extra stuff when you gotta be rich. Yeah, pretty much,

0:08:24.240 --> 0:08:24.800
<v Speaker 1>it sounds like.

0:08:24.920 --> 0:08:28.840
<v Speaker 3>Unfortunately, yeah, those are all like super expensive roofs, right, Yes.

0:08:29.120 --> 0:08:32.440
<v Speaker 1>All three of them are, for sure. So yeah, yeah,

0:08:32.520 --> 0:08:34.000
<v Speaker 1>I mean it is true if you think about it,

0:08:34.040 --> 0:08:36.960
<v Speaker 1>you don't want to use asphalt shingles to catch rain

0:08:37.040 --> 0:08:40.520
<v Speaker 1>with unless chuck you have a good filter, and they

0:08:40.559 --> 0:08:43.200
<v Speaker 1>definitely make those kinds of things, because there are some

0:08:43.280 --> 0:08:45.199
<v Speaker 1>things you want to keep in mind when you're choosing

0:08:45.200 --> 0:08:47.240
<v Speaker 1>a rain barrel, but one of them is you need

0:08:47.440 --> 0:08:48.839
<v Speaker 1>a filter of some sort.
